Circular Cable Assemblies

1. Overview

Circular Cable Assemblies are engineered interconnect solutions designed to transmit electrical signals or power through circular-shaped connectors. These assemblies combine multiple wires or cables terminated with circular connectors, ensuring reliable connectivity in demanding environments. Their importance spans across industries requiring robust, high-density, and high-performance connections, particularly in applications where space constraints and environmental resilience are critical.

3. Structure and Components

A typical circular cable assembly consists of:

  • Conductors: Copper/aluminum for signal/power transmission
  • Insulation: PVC/TPE/PUR jackets for dielectric protection
  • Shielding: Braided copper or foil for EMI/RFI protection
  • Connector Housing: Metal/plastic shells with precision contacts
  • Retention System: Latches, threads, or bayonet couplings

Modular designs allow customization with hybrid signal/power/RF configurations.

4. Key Technical Specifications

Parameter Importance
Current Rating (Amps) Determines power transmission capacity
Voltage Rating (Volts) Defines dielectric strength and safety margins
Contact Resistance (m ) Impacts signal integrity and power efficiency
Operating Temperature (-40 C to +125 C) Ensures reliability in extreme environments
Mating Cycles (1000-10,000) Indicates mechanical durability
IP Rating (IP65-IP68) Defines environmental protection level

7. Selection Guidelines

Key considerations:

  • Electrical requirements (current/voltage profiles)
  • Environmental conditions (temperature, moisture, chemical exposure)
  • Mechanical demands (vibration, mating cycles, cable bend radius)
  • Space constraints (connector size and orientation)
  • Industry-specific certifications (e.g., MIL-STD, UL, RoHS)

Recommend verifying compatibility with existing infrastructure and performing thermal cycling tests for critical applications.
